We are doing client copy via client export import.We used SAP_ALL client copy profile. We were expecting 3 files O,T and X . But we got only 2 files T and X. We checked at the OS level , and client copy logs SCC3. SCC3 shows only two transport request created and OS level has only 2 set of files.

Where is transport request O and its files?

Then we proceed and did the import in target client. But import error happened, it showed import stopped because of ztable were missing from nametab. how to proceed the import? Without solving the O file problem we cannot do the import ?

Have you performed a test run with a remote comparison before the export? Both ABAP dictionaries should be the same, otherwise you cannot import... For example: if you have a Z_TEST table on your source, but not on your target system, your import will fail.

In case you want to exclude tables from your CC, you can do this via report RSCCEXPT.

That you have 2 transports instead of 3 doesn't have to be any problem.

The package to which a table belongs is shown in transaction se11 -> table name -> attributes.

Client copy completed.

The SAP_EXPA worked fine, and we got O files also as a result. But we did not follow that method because we did not want to affect the system availability and data consistency of the other clients in the same SAP instance. Hence O file import is not done. We transported the missing ztables to target system. We manually created the transport request using se03. Still we had problem while running scc7 after import. For this we used Note 1235955 after post processing
